The main differences between pecan pie and ravioli

  • Pecan pie is richer than ravioli in manganese, selenium, vitamin B1, iron, vitamin B2, copper, phosphorus, and zinc.
  • Daily need coverage for cholesterol for pecan pie is 28% higher.
  • Pecan pie contains 6 times more saturated fat than ravioli. Pecan pie contains 3.989g of saturated fat, while ravioli contains 0.723g.
  • Ravioli contains less cholesterol.
  • Ravioli has a lower glycemic index than pecan pie.

Food types used in this article are Pie, pecan, prepared from recipe and Ravioli, cheese-filled, canned.
